Output 8ebfabe6f2796d859c4fb5d1d133732c27054a558c36d4ac80b9d92959f23a16:1

value
652643
script pubkey
OP_0 OP_PUSHBYTES_20 2b011c31263af55672a78b02da951e56d75dac60
address
bc1q9vq3cvfx8t64vu483vpd49g72mt4mtrq273646
transaction
8ebfabe6f2796d859c4fb5d1d133732c27054a558c36d4ac80b9d92959f23a16
spent
true